Detox Unit returns with first original release in 3 years

Detox Unit blesses fans with an explosive new single “Detonator,” his first original release in nearly three years.

Experimental bass producer Detox Unit has officially kicked off his next musical chapter with the release of “Detonator,” his first original single since the arrival of his hit 2023 album ‘Liminal’, delivering a fresh dose of his trademark sound.

Released July 24, the new track marks the Denver-based artist’s return after spending the past year focused on creating new music. While ‘Liminal’ showcased Detox Unit’s intricate approach to experimental bass, “Detonator” shifts toward a more direct, high-impact sound built for massive sound systems.

Driven by a gritty hip-hop vocal sample and bouncing low-end, “Detonator” blends the producer’s signature precision with a heavier, festival-ready energy. The result is a track that maintains the detailed production fans have come to expect while leaning further into explosive dancefloor momentum.

The release follows a busy stretch on the road for Detox Unit. Earlier this summer, he made two surprise appearances at Electric Forest, including a performance on the Good Life Stage and his first-ever back-to-back set alongside Thought Process at Grand Artique.

His touring schedule continues throughout the remainder of 2026 with headline performances scheduled for Sound Haven and Nocturnal Valley, along with appearances at Secret Dreams, Telluride Town Park, and Eternal NYE in Orlando.

Known for pushing the boundaries of experimental bass music, Detox Unit has built a loyal following through intricate releases and immersive live performances. His diverse catalog includes ‘The Abyss’ (2016), ‘Deviate’ (2019), ‘Liminal’ (2023), and the ongoing ‘Recent Works’ series. His performances have become staples within Tipper‘s extended community and curated events.

With “Detonator,” Detox Unit offers the first glimpse at what’s next, signaling the beginning of a new era while delivering a track designed to hit just as hard on festival stages as it does at home. Listen below.
